Identification of Cup-Disk Ratio for Glaucoma Prone Eyes

Abstract

In the framework of completely computer assisted diagnosis of glaucoma, an advanced algorithm that identifies the optic cup and optic disk, determines the radius by segmenting out the optic cup and disk and calculates the ratio of the optic cup to disk radius in fundus images of the macula is presented and discussed in this paper. The parameters of thecup to disk ratio in the optic disk region of retina are hallmark of glaucoma detection and allow itsdetection with a high sensitivity. Since detection of the ratio of optic cup to disk radius is asignificant diagnostic task, a major role is being handled by the computer assistance. The optic disk has been found by using red color space image as the optic disk is brighter considering to the other macula region and the contours are identified by means of morphological reconstruction techniques. The detection of optic cup has been done by using the green color space image. The optic disc and the optic cup have been detected by means of thresholding and morphological reconstruction technique.
